混合土地利用对不同类型降雨事件下的城市雨水质量的影响
Haibin Yan1, David Z Zhu2, Mark R Loewen1
1Department of Civil and Environmental Engineering, University of Alberta, Edmonton, AB T6G 1H9, Canada.
The Science of the total environment
|August 1, 2024
概括
混合土地使用和降雨类型显著影响城市雨水质量,影响污染物水平和负载. 了解这些相互作用是管理排放污染的关键.

背景情况:
- 城市排水是污染水的主要来源.
- 众所周知,混合土地用途和降雨特征会影响雨水质量.
研究的目的:
- 调查混合土地使用和降雨事件类型对城市雨水质量的综合影响.
- 为了评估城市排水中的总悬浮沉积物 (TSS),和.
主要方法:
- 在四个城市水域开展为期两年的现场监测计划.
- 事件平均度 (EMC) 和事件污染物负载 (EPL) 的分析.
- 相关性分析和多重线性回归 (MLR) 模型.
主要成果:
- 大多数和污染物存在于颗粒形式.
- 污染物负载 (EPL) 与降雨的相关性比污染物度 (EMC) 更强.
- 短暂而强烈的降雨和长期干旱的事件增加了污染物度.
结论:
- 混合土地使用复杂性和降雨特征显著影响城市雨水污染物产生和运输.
- 雨水质量因土地使用,降雨类型和季节而异.
- MLR模型可以预测雨水质量,通过考虑土地使用的复杂性来提高准确性.

Flood risk assessment involves careful planning and analysis to ensure the safety of communities near water retention structures. Capacity contours are a vital tool in this process, as they illustrate the potential spread of water at specific levels in a given area. In the context of building a bund across a small valley, these contours play a critical role in evaluating the safety of nearby residential areas.In this example, the bund is intended to store stormwater in the valley. Stormwater detention basins are essential in managing runoff during heavy rainfall, particularly in urban areas where impervious surfaces increase the risk of flooding. Understanding the conservation of mass in these systems allows engineers to optimize basin performance, balancing inflow, outflow, and water storage.

Though evaporation from plant leaves drives transpiration, it also results in loss of water. Because water is critical for photosynthetic reactions and other cellular processes, evolutionary pressures on plants in different environments have driven the acquisition of adaptations that reduce water loss.
